"20,000 Leagues Under the Sea" - Summary

"20,000 Leagues Under the Sea" is a captivating science fiction novel by Jules Verne that takes readers on an extraordinary underwater adventure. The story follows Professor Pierre Aronnax, a French marine biologist, who is invited to join an expedition to hunt down a mysterious sea creature. Along with his loyal servant Conseil and the Canadian whaler Ned Land, Aronnax finds himself aboard the Nautilus, a state-of-the-art submarine commanded by the enigmatic Captain Nemo. As they traverse the world's oceans, they encounter breathtaking marine life, sunken treasures, and face numerous dangers. This novel is special for its imaginative depiction of underwater exploration and its profound commentary on humanity and nature. Verne's vivid storytelling and visionary ideas make it a must-read for anyone fascinated by the mysteries of the deep sea.

Key Themes

1

Exploration and Discovery

: The novel emphasizes the spirit of exploration and the quest for knowledge. Through the journey of the Nautilus, readers are introduced to the wonders of the underwater world, showcasing the beauty and diversity of marine life. This theme highlights the human desire to explore the unknown and push the boundaries of scientific understanding.

2

Isolation and Freedom

: Captain Nemo's character embodies the theme of isolation and the quest for freedom. Having renounced society, Nemo finds solace and autonomy in the depths of the ocean. This theme explores the complexities of seeking freedom from societal constraints and the consequences of living in isolation, raising questions about the balance between independence and human connection.

3

Man vs. Nature

: The novel delves into the relationship between humans and the natural world. The encounters with various sea creatures and the challenges faced by the crew of the Nautilus underscore the power and unpredictability of nature. This theme serves as a reminder of the respect and humility required when interacting with the natural environment, as well as the potential consequences of exploiting it.

"Twenty Thousand Leagues Under the Seas" is a seminal science fiction and adventure novel by the renowned French author Jules Verne. First serialized between March 1869 and June 1870 in a periodical magazine, the novel was later published in book form in 1870. This work is one of Verne's most celebrated novels, alongside "Around the World in Eighty Days" and "Journey to the Center of the Earth."

The story unfolds in an era when submarines were still in their infancy. It remarkably predicts many features of modern underwater vessels, a testament to Verne's visionary imagination. The narrative revolves around the marine biologist Pierre Aronnax, who, along with his companions, is taken prisoner by Captain Nemo aboard the Nautilus, a highly advanced submarine.
